Excellent slim, ideal for scanning 2-3 pages iregularly November 26, 2007 D. Vora (UK) 4 out of 4 found this review helpful
The unit is a bit slow for scanning loads of pages, ideal if you only intend to scan a few pages a day, heavy use takes time for it to process data. Apart from that quality, price, size its all perfect. :)Definitely recommended

Solid and reliable; easy to install and use July 24, 2007 S. Hill (Durham, England) 13 out of 13 found this review helpful
In my experience, a scanner works or it doesn't. Speed is the second consideration. The sw which comes with this item works well. It is easy to install and works faultlessly thereafter. The scanner is no faster than the one I had (10 years) before. It's reasonably fast but that's it. I don't know if this is as fast as any: I suspect it is. However, it needs no external power. The results are fine.
Caution Vista Users July 22, 2007 Mr. John Mason (Cardiff UK) 13 out of 24 found this review helpful
No drivers are available for Vista x64 and, according to Canon "nothing is currently planned for 64bit operating systems".
